【目的】丰富我国北方紫菜(Pyropia)栽培种质,培育优良新品系。【方法】以山东长岛县砣矶岛野生紫菜作为亲本,经过选育,分别采集在南通、日照和砣矶岛海区栽培的“黄优1号”紫菜成体进行遗传背景(rbcL和细胞色素C氧化酶Ⅰ亚基(Cycochrome oxidase subunitⅠ,COⅠ)基因)和营养成分(藻胆蛋白、叶绿素a Chl a、类胡萝卜素Car和可溶性蛋白TSPs)分析。【结果】依据rbcL基因序列(约1 200bp)进行遗传多样性分析,仅砣矶岛养殖绳上全沉水生长的野生紫菜群体与其他品系(群体)具有1.1%的遗传差异,而其栽培群体(“黄优1号”)的rbcL基因序列与对照条斑紫菜品系完全一致;依据COⅠ基因序列(约680bp),仅南通的两栽培品系(“黄优1号”和培育品系2)具有2bp差异,其他品系(群体)的COⅠ基因序列与对照条斑紫菜完全一致。日照海区栽培的“黄优1号”紫菜其营养物质含量比其他海区栽培的“黄优1号”紫菜、野生亲本以及培育品系2高;南通海区栽培的“黄优1号”条斑紫菜品质一般,大部分营养物质含量均低于日照栽培藻体。【结论】由rbcL和COⅠ基因序列推断砣矶岛岸边和养殖绳上的野生紫菜大部分为条斑紫菜,选育品系“黄优1号”为条斑紫菜;在不同海区进行栽培的“黄优1号”条斑紫菜营养成分均优于其野生亲本;初步研究结果表明该品系更适于在日照海区栽培。
【Objective】 To enrich the cultivated germplasm of Pyropia in northern China and cultivate new excellent lines. 【Method】 Using wild seaweed from Laodejiao Island in Changdao County of Shandong Province as the parent, we collected the genetic background (rbcL and cytochromes) from cultivated “Huangyou 1” seaweed in the sea areas of Nantong, Rizhao and Dianxiao Island, (COⅠ) gene and nutrient components (phycobiliprotein, chlorophyll a Chl a, carotenoid Car and soluble protein TSPs). 【Result】 Based on the analysis of genetic diversity of the rbcL gene sequence (about 1 200 bp), only 1.1% of the genetic diversity among the wild seaweed population grown on sub-submerged rope on the Roxois Island was 1.1%, while that of the cultivated population The rbcL gene sequence of “Huangyou 1” was completely consistent with that of the control Porphyra yezoensis. Based on the COⅠ gene sequence (about 680bp), only two Nantong cultivars (“Huangyou 1” 2) had a 2bp difference. The COI gene sequences of other lines (groups) were completely identical with that of the control Porphyra yezoensis. The cultivated “Yellow No. 1” seaweed cultivated in Rizhao had higher nutrient content than the cultivated “Huangyou No.1” seaweed, wild parent and cultivar in other sea areas; “Huangyou No.1 ”Porphyra quality in general, most of the nutrients are lower than the sunshine culture algae. 【Conclusion】 The results showed that the majority of wild seaweed on the shore of the Rocky Island and on the ropes was Porphyra yezoensis, and the breeding line “Huangyou 1” was Porphyra yezoensis, which was derived from rbcL and COⅠ gene sequences. The results showed that the strain is more suitable for cultivation in Rizhao sea area.
